Yes, the wires can be spliced and soldered. You might want to check out this short video first:

First slide a piece of heat-shrink tubing onto one of the wires. Instead of twisting the wires together like we do with house wiring, I prefer to slide the two ends into each other, then press down any strands that may have stood up. Solder the splice, then slide the heat-shrink tubing over it to seal the joint. Use a needle nose pliers first to press down any strands so they don't poke through the tubing. Never use electrical tape to seal the splices as that will unravel into a gooey mess on a hot day.
